Hepplewhite Drawer Pulls - Federal furniture handles are a truly functional and elegant style. These oval cabinet pulls offer a neoclassic design with intricate lines, sweeping curves and pleasing proportions.  The size of this style tended to be slightly smaller than those of the prior period. Each is made of sheet brass, a new manufacturing method. Designs are crisply stamped into the brass thereby creating embossed shapes. They display classic scenes, acorns, leaves and circular motifs.  These oval cabinet pulls have a bail that swings from two posts. Choose polished or antique finishes. They are beautifully made to enhance both new and old furniture. Use with brass keyhole covers.

An English cabinet maker, by the name of George Hepplewhite, created this style. After becoming popular in England, his designs crossed the Atlantic. They then took America by storm in the late 1700's. Thus began the Federal Period. Furniture styles were updated to reflect these new trends. A French splayed foot, curved apron and serpentine front chest became popular.
